University of North Carolina - Charlotte is a public university in Charlotte, North Carolina. University of North Carolina at Charlotte was founded in 1946 and enrolls 34,158 students.

Cost Breakdown In State Out-of-State
Tuition $3,812 $18,474
Fees $3,402 $3,402
Room and Board $13,864 $13,864
Books $950 $950
Total (Before Financial Aid): $22,028 $36,690
